Login
Últimos assuntos
Estatísticas
Temos 88 usuários registradosO último usuário registrado atende pelo nome de paulomario
Os nossos membros postaram um total de 2285 mensagens em 269 assuntos
Operadores de programação (C, C++, C#, Javascript e outros)
SMW Tech :: TECNOLOGIA :: Computação :: Programação
Página 1 de 1 • Compartilhe •
Operadores de programação (C, C++, C#, Javascript e outros)
Aqui tem uma lista de operadores normalmente utilizados nas programações gerais. Até agora só sei mesmo que C, C++, C#, JScript.NET, Javascript e outros. Mas alguns podem ter modificações e outros podem até não suporta alguns. Mas aqui está a lista:
*** INCOMPLETO ***
*** INCOMPLETO ***
| Nome | Símbolo | Descrição |
| Adição | n + n | Adiciona o número n por outro número n. |
| Subtração | n - n | Subtrai o número n por outro número n |
| Multiplicação | n * n | Multiplica n por outro n vezes. |
| Divisor | n / n | Divide o n por n(outro) |
| Mover bits para esquerda | n << x | Move os bits contido em n para a esquerda x vezes. Por exemplo n = 14, n = 1110, n = n << 2, n = 111000, n = 56 |
| Move os bits contido em n para a direita x vezes. | n >> x | Mesmo que n << x, porém move os bits para a DIREITA. |
Re: Operadores de programação (C, C++, C#, Javascript e outros)
Aqui alguns: (Não sei fazer essa table massinha, então você adiciona ai)
& (Operador lógico AND) - n & n - Aplica a operação lógica AND (1 & 1 = 1, caso contrario, = 0)
&& (Operador lógico AND) - String && String - A mesma coisa, mas para alguns casos necessita-se usar &&
|| (Operador lógico OR) - (condição) || (condição) - Caso alguma das condições seja verdadeira... continue
% (Módulo) - n % n - Operação módulo, retorna o resto da divisão
% (porcentagem) - x% de n - Depende da forma que você usa. Significa n/100 * x.
& (Operador lógico AND) - n & n - Aplica a operação lógica AND (1 & 1 = 1, caso contrario, = 0)
&& (Operador lógico AND) - String && String - A mesma coisa, mas para alguns casos necessita-se usar &&
|| (Operador lógico OR) - (condição) || (condição) - Caso alguma das condições seja verdadeira... continue
% (Módulo) - n % n - Operação módulo, retorna o resto da divisão
% (porcentagem) - x% de n - Depende da forma que você usa. Significa n/100 * x.
Re: Operadores de programação (C, C++, C#, Javascript e outros)
Boa Unde, me ajudou bastante.
Agora mais alguns:
== (Operador de comparação) - x == y - Retorna true se x e y forem iguais, mas false se não forem.
!= (Operador de comparação) - x != y - Retorna true se x e y NÃO forem iguais, mas se retornar false, eles são iguais.
! (Operador not) - !x - Ele inverte as booleans, então se for true o x, ele vira false, se o x é false, então fica true.
^ (Operador XOR) - x ^ y - Ele aplica uma operação inversa no número x. Simplificando: Ele inverte os bits.
Agora mais alguns:
== (Operador de comparação) - x == y - Retorna true se x e y forem iguais, mas false se não forem.
!= (Operador de comparação) - x != y - Retorna true se x e y NÃO forem iguais, mas se retornar false, eles são iguais.
! (Operador not) - !x - Ele inverte as booleans, então se for true o x, ele vira false, se o x é false, então fica true.
^ (Operador XOR) - x ^ y - Ele aplica uma operação inversa no número x. Simplificando: Ele inverte os bits.
Re: Operadores de programação (C, C++, C#, Javascript e outros)
Bom, unde, em C, normalmente x % y quer dizer o RESTO da divisão inteira de x por y (operação MOD). Espero ter ajudado.

Manuz, major Flare- Grande Estrela

- Mensagens: 454
Pontos: 901
Data de inscrição: 04/10/2011
Idade: 17
Localização: Your mind!
Humor: I'm a mind bender.
Re: Operadores de programação (C, C++, C#, Javascript e outros)
Sim, eu sei, foi isso que eu quis dizer: Operação módulo, retorna o resto da divisão
Re: Operadores de programação (C, C++, C#, Javascript e outros)
Me desculpe, unde, é por que entendo módulo como valor absoluto de um número, ou seja, o comprimento do vetor que ele determina no espaço (basicamente, é o número sem sinal.).

Manuz, major Flare- Grande Estrela

- Mensagens: 454
Pontos: 901
Data de inscrição: 04/10/2011
Idade: 17
Localização: Your mind!
Humor: I'm a mind bender.
Re: Operadores de programação (C, C++, C#, Javascript e outros)
Só uma breve pergunta, em matematica, !n = fatorial do número (Ex: !5 = 1.2.3.4.5), se em vez de booleana eu colocar um número, ele irá calcular o fatorial?
Re: Operadores de programação (C, C++, C#, Javascript e outros)
Isso deve variar com o que você está programando, mas normalmente, não.
Re: Operadores de programação (C, C++, C#, Javascript e outros)
Bem, unde, devo dizer que até onde sei, não existe nenhuma função que calcule fatorial de um número. Isso quer dizer que para calculá-lo, você deve criar uma função para ele, utilizando uma simples, porém prática, estrutura de repetição (comandos while, do-while e for). O problema é que esse operador !x, como o vilela disse, é booleano, ou seja, só funciona com true ou false.
A propósito, a notação de fatorial é n!, não !n.
A propósito, a notação de fatorial é n!, não !n.
Última edição por Manuz, major Flare em 17/10/2011, 19:15, editado 1 vez(es) (Razão : erro de post)

Manuz, major Flare- Grande Estrela

- Mensagens: 454
Pontos: 901
Data de inscrição: 04/10/2011
Idade: 17
Localização: Your mind!
Humor: I'm a mind bender.
Re: Operadores de programação (C, C++, C#, Javascript e outros)
ai ai saudades de programar em c++, estou até a procura de emprego no info jobs como programador c++ mas sem formação superior :/

dnnzao- Estrela Nova

- Mensagens: 31
Pontos: 239
Data de inscrição: 15/11/2011
SMW Tech :: TECNOLOGIA :: Computação :: Programação
Página 1 de 1
Permissão deste fórum:
Você não pode responder aos tópicos neste fórum



















» Lunar Magic 2.01!
» Novos updates em breve
» My english isn't better now?
» Imagens e Vídeos de sua hack!
» Recomende um jogo
» Random Bar, Random Conversa
» Super Mario Bros. Classics
» Desculpe, mas